Handover for the weekly sync: telemetry payload compression in Signalcrate moved from gzip to the new Packmule codec, cutting average payload size by roughly 40%. Decoder fallback stays live for two releases. Remaining work: benchmark cold-start cost on edge collectors. Questions about this workstream should go to the person named below.

named custodian: Oliath Ralax

Ticket: SEC-887 — Config drift: spreadsheet export memory limits

For your review: the Tidemark export service's memory limits in production no longer match the approved baseline. Someone raised the per-worker cap during an incident in June to stop OOM kills on large spreadsheet exports, and the change was never reverted or documented. This widens the blast radius of a malicious oversized export. Requesting sign-off on either formalizing or reverting. The values currently deployed are listed below.

service settings:
[casax]
port = 6379
team = rusir
host = casax.zemvarhq.corp
region = outer-4
access_code = ac_9808ce
timeout_ms = 1500

Runbook: account recovery for the Nightloom backfill scheduler. New team members: if the scheduler's service account is locked (usually after three failed vault fetches during a nightly run), backfills will silently stall rather than error. First, confirm the lockout in the audit panel, then pause all pending jobs to avoid duplicate writes. Recovery requires the emergency operator login on the scheduler host, which is kept offline for safety. When that login prompts you, supply the passphrase below.

strongbox words: jorix-norys-aldius-druax

Handover note — Crumbwheel order cutoffs.

Welcome aboard. The bakery cutoff rule in Crumbwheel closes same-day orders at 14:00 local to each storefront, not UTC — this has bitten us twice. Holiday overrides live in the calendar service and take precedence silently, so always check there first when a cutoff looks wrong. To unlock the calendar service's admin console after a restart, enter the recovery passphrase below.

vault phrase of bagap-bahaf = silion-pelox-sorox-casdor-quenwyn-fraax-eliox-praael-kelion-quenvan-kasox-rusael-norius-belvan